Transilvania University of Brașov informs the academic community that, between May and June 2026, the national research on the Romanian students’ life and study conditions is being conducted, through the EUROSTUDENT 9 questionnaire. This survey aims at providing an overview of the students’ socio-economic profile and experience during their academic years.
In the aforementioned period, the students enrolled in both bachelor’s and master’s study programmes will receive, by email, the call to fill out the EUROSTUDENT 9 questionnaire. The survey aims at answering relevant questions on the students’ average income, access to fellowships and scholarships, proportion in terms of employment, as well as on how the status of employed student influences their educational path and academic experience. Aspects such as the life and study conditions, the time assigned to educational activities, the labour market situation, the income and expenses, as well as the participation in internships and international mobilities are analysed, too.
EUROSTUDENT is a transnational research which is conducted in over 25 countries of Europe, with a view to collecting comparative data on the social and economic dimension of the student life. The Ministry of Education and Research (MEC) coordinates the national implementation thereof, through the Executive Agency for Higher Education, Research, Development and Innovation Funding (UEFISCDI) and the National Center for Policies and Evaluation in Education – Educational Research Unit (CNPEE-UCE).
